Subject: [PATCH v4 02/11] Defer minimal symbol name-setting

Currently the demangled name of a minimal symbol is set when creating
the symbol.  However, there is no intrinsic need to do this.  This
patch instead arranges for the demangling to be done just before the
minsym hash tables are filled.  This will be useful in a later patch.

gdb/ChangeLog
2019-10-01  Tom Tromey  <tom@tromey.com>

	* symtab.h (struct minimal_symbol) <name_set>: New member.
	* minsyms.c (minimal_symbol_reader::record_full): Copy name.
	Don't call symbol_set_names.
	(minimal_symbol_reader::install): Call symbol_set_names.

diff --git a/gdb/minsyms.c b/gdb/minsyms.c
index 83f5d895779..2b259d39c11 100644
--- a/gdb/minsyms.c
+++ b/gdb/minsyms.c
@@ -1106,7 +1106,11 @@ minimal_symbol_reader::record_full (const char *name, int name_len,
   msymbol = &m_msym_bunch->contents[m_msym_bunch_index];
   symbol_set_language (msymbol, language_auto,
 		       &m_objfile->per_bfd->storage_obstack);
-  symbol_set_names (msymbol, name, name_len, copy_name, m_objfile->per_bfd);
+
+  if (copy_name)
+    name = (char *) obstack_copy0 (&m_objfile->per_bfd->storage_obstack,
+				   name, name_len);
+  msymbol->name = name;
 
   SET_MSYMBOL_VALUE_ADDRESS (msymbol, address);
   MSYMBOL_SECTION (msymbol) = section;
@@ -1327,6 +1331,18 @@ minimal_symbol_reader::install ()
       m_objfile->per_bfd->minimal_symbol_count = mcount;
       m_objfile->per_bfd->msymbols = std::move (msym_holder);
 
+      msymbols = m_objfile->per_bfd->msymbols.get ();
+      for (int i = 0; i < mcount; ++i)
+	{
+	  if (!msymbols[i].name_set)
+	    {
+	      symbol_set_names (&msymbols[i], msymbols[i].name,
+				strlen (msymbols[i].name), 0,
+				m_objfile->per_bfd);
+	      msymbols[i].name_set = 1;
+	    }
+	}
+
       build_minimal_symbol_hash_tables (m_objfile);
     }
 }
diff --git a/gdb/symtab.h b/gdb/symtab.h
index 1f0fc62a657..c3918a85af7 100644
--- a/gdb/symtab.h
+++ b/gdb/symtab.h
@@ -669,6 +669,10 @@ struct minimal_symbol : public general_symbol_info
      the object file format may not carry that piece of information.  */
   unsigned int has_size : 1;
 
+  /* Non-zero if this symbol ever had its demangled name set (even if
+     it was set to NULL).  */
+  unsigned int name_set : 1;
+
   /* Minimal symbols with the same hash key are kept on a linked
      list.  This is the link.  */
